The No. 1 Ladies' Detective Agency is a television comedy-drama series based on the novels of the same name by Alexander McCall Smith. The novels focus on the story of a detective agency opened by Mma Ramotswe and her courtship with the mechanic Mr. J. L. B. Matekoni. The series was filmed on location in Botswana and was seen as one of the first major television productions to be undertaken in the country. HBO did not renew the show after its first series, but announced in summer 2011 that the series might continue as two or more standalone films. HBO announced they had decided not to move forward with the project.
